Our Client, a Healthcare company, is looking for a Pharmacy Technician for their Waimea, HI location.
 
Responsibilities:
  • Assist the pharmacist in preparing physician orders by pulling labels generated by the pharmacist and filling with the appropriate medication.  This process may include the preparing and sending of a unit dosed oral medication, a reconstituted medication, a topical medication, or an IV solution, as specified by the label.
  • Prepare intravenous, epidural, or intrathecal solutions (large volume solutions, IVPB, syringes, TPNs, etc.) using sterile technique, according to Pharmacy Sterile Compounding SOPs and current sterile compounding regulations.
  • Refer all completed drug orders to the pharmacist for checking before dispensing.
  • Adhere to safety/infection control policies and procedures.  Report any unsafe equipment or practices.
  • Answer telephone calls and triage to appropriate person according to departmental guidelines.
  • Maintain a clean, well-stocked, and safe environment for patients and staff.
  • Pre-pack medications as unit dosed items for administration when necessary or when requested by pharmacist.
  • Remove outdated medications from stock and automated dispensing machines.
  • Perform daily stocking and filling of pharmacy shelves, automated dispensing machines throughout the hospital, as assigned by pharmacist.
  • Maintain crash cart trays and emergency medication boxes.
  • Deliver completed drug orders to the appropriate floors or authorized individual caring for the patient.
  • Fulfill any special request from the pharmacist to service a particular need within the pharmacy or hospital, or in any emergent patient-specific situation.
  • Adhere to scheduled breaks and lunch times as assigned by pharmacist.
  • Complete annual and one-time competency assessments as determined by departmental policy.
  • Maintain the strictest confidentiality of all patient and facility-related employee information.
  • Employ the use of pro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) when handling hazardous materials.
  • Maintain temperature logs of refrigerators within the Pharmacy; maintain I.V. inventory and supplies; perform daily narcotic pulls; unpack, check, and stock all incoming medications and supplies in adherence with requirements of the Drug Supply Chain Security Act (DSCSA); assist nursing staff in troubleshooting Pyxis related problems when requested; perform special projects as assigned by the Director or designee and perform other related duties as assigned.
 
Requirements:
  • Valid certificate of registration as a registered pharmacy technician issued by Board of Pharmacy, State of Hawaii.
  • Two (2) years of work experience in a pharmacy setting (i.e., community pharmacy, hospitals, other medical institutions) assisting a Pharmacist in providing pharmaceutical services in accordance with established procedures and methods.
